The Role: GBS is seeking a highly motivated, analytical, and results-oriented Paid Media Specialist to support the planning, execution, optimisation, and reporting of paid digital marketing campaigns across multiple online advertising platforms.
The role is responsible for driving high-quality student lead generation and maximising campaign performance through data-driven paid media strategies. The successful candidate will play a critical role in supporting student recruitment objectives by delivering targeted, conversion-focused campaigns aligned with organisational growth goals. This position requires a highly hands-on individual with strong technical expertise in campaign setup, audience targeting, conversion tracking, optimisation, reporting, and performance analysis across multiple paid media channels.
The ideal candidate will possess a strong understanding of digital marketing best practices, customer acquisition funnels, and paid media optimisation techniques, combined with the ability to work collaboratively across marketing, recruitment, and creative teams.

What the Role Involves:
-
Paid Media & Digital Campaign Management: Lead, manage, and optimise multi-channel digital marketing campaigns across Google Ads (Search, Display, YouTube), TikTok Ads, and Meta (Facebook & Instagram) to drive high-quality leads and maximise ROI.
-
Paid Media Strategy Development: Develop and implement the overarching paid media strategy aligned with organisational brand positioning and student recruitment objectives.
-
Budget Management: Manage campaign budgets effectively to maximise ROI, cost-efficiency, and overall campaign performance.
-
Audience Targeting: Design and execute precise targeting strategies to reach mid-career professionals and senior-level decision-makers across relevant industries.
- Brand Management: Strengthen and maintain consistent brand positioning, messaging, and visual identity across all communication channels and touchpoints.
-
Tracking & Attribution Management: Implement and manage campaign tracking, attribution models, and audience segmentation using tools such as CRM, Google Tag Manager, Google Analytics, Meta business manager.
-
Market Trends & Innovation: Stay up to date with the latest paid media trends, tools, and best practices to maintain a competitive advantage.
About You:
- Paid Media Expertise: 3–5+ years of experience managing campaigns across Google Ads, LinkedIn Ads, and Meta platforms.
- Strategic & Performance Focus: Proven ability to lead paid marketing initiatives and deliver measurable outcomes such as improved ROI, CPL, and conversions.
- Audience Targeting Experience: Experience targeting professional audiences, ideally within education, training, or industry-specific sectors.
- Data & Analytical Skills: Strong analytical and reporting capabilities with hands-on experience using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ager, CRM, and Power BI.
- Communication & Copywriting: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to craft compelling marketing messages.
- Project Management: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ple campaigns simultaneously and meet deadlines.
- Collaboration: Ability to work independently while effectively collaborating with cross-functional and international teams.
